Core Components of Construction SEO

Effective SEO for construction addresses specific ranking factors.
Google Business Profile Optimisation
GBP is essential for local construction visibility:
Profile Completion:
Essential Information:
- Accurate company name (no keyword stuffing)
- Full address (or service area if no public office)
- Phone number
- Website URL
- Hours of operation
- Service area definition
Category Selection:
| Business Type | Primary Category |
| General builder | General Contractor, Building Firm |
| House builder | Home Builder |
| Commercial contractor | Commercial Contractor |
| Renovation specialist | Remodeler, Home Improvement |
| Extension builder | Home Builder, General Contractor |
| Fit-out contractor | General Contractor |
Add relevant secondary categories:
- Kitchen Remodeler
- Bathroom Remodeler
- Roofing Contractor
- Deck Builder
- Patio Enclosure Supplier
Services List: Add all services with descriptions:
- House extensions
- New build construction
- Loft conversions
- Garage conversions
- Kitchen extensions
- Commercial fit-outs
- Office refurbishment
- Renovation and restoration
- Project management
Visual Content:
Construction GBP benefits enormously from strong imagery:
| Photo Type | Purpose | Best Practice |
| Completed projects | Showcase capability | High-quality, professional shots |
| In-progress work | Show active business | Demonstrates scale and approach |
| Before/after | Demonstrate transformation | Side-by-side comparisons |
| Team | Build trust | Professional, on-site imagery |
| Equipment | Show capability | Modern plant and machinery |
| Awards/accreditations | Build credibility | Certificate and trophy images |
Photo Strategy:
- Professional photography of completed projects
- Regular uploads of ongoing work
- Variety of project types
- Different scales of work
- Interior and exterior shots
Google Posts:
Regular posting signals active business:
Post Types:
- Project completions
- Progress updates
- Award announcements
- Team news
- Industry insights
- Seasonal offers
Attributes:
Complete relevant attributes:
- Identifies as veteran-owned (if applicable)
- Identifies as women-owned (if applicable)
- Free estimates
- Online appointments
- Languages spoken
Service Page Optimisation
Each service requires dedicated, comprehensive content:
Essential Service Pages:
Residential:
- House extensions
- New build homes
- Loft conversions
- Garage conversions
- Home renovations
- Kitchen extensions
- Basement conversions
- Orangeries and conservatories
Commercial:
- Commercial construction
- Office fit-outs
- Retail fit-outs
- Industrial buildings
- Warehouse construction
- Restaurant/hospitality fit-outs
Service Page Structure:
H1: [Service] in [Location] | [Company Name]
Introduction: What the service involves, typical projects
H2: Our [Service] Expertise
Experience and approach
Types of projects undertaken
H2: The [Service] Process
How we work
Timeline expectations
Client involvement
H2: [Service] Costs and Budgeting
What affects price
Typical ranges (where appropriate)
Payment structures
H2: Planning Permission and Regulations
Building regulations
Planning requirements
How we help
H2: Recent [Service] Projects
Case study summaries
Links to full portfolio items
H2: Why Choose [Company] for [Service]
Differentiators
Accreditations
Guarantees
H2: [Service] FAQs
Common questions
H2: Get a Quote
Clear call to action
Content Depth:
Construction service pages benefit from substantial content:
Include:
- Detailed process explanations
- Typical timelines
- Planning and regulation guidance
- Material options and recommendations
- Budgeting guidance
- Project management approach
- Aftercare and guarantees
Demonstrate Expertise:
- Technical knowledge
- Regulatory understanding
- Practical experience
- Problem-solving capability

Portfolio and Case Study Development
Project portfolios are crucial for construction SEO:
Portfolio Page Structure:
Individual Project Pages:
H1: [Project Type] | [Location] | [Company Name]
Project overview
H2: Project Brief
Client requirements
Challenges
H2: Our Approach
Design and planning
Construction methodology
H2: Project Details
– Size/scope
– Duration
– Key features
– Materials used
H2: Results
Completed project description
Client feedback
Image Gallery: Multiple high-quality images
SEO Value of Case Studies:
| Benefit | How It Helps |
| Unique content | Each project is original content |
| Local relevance | Location-specific pages |
| Keyword targeting | Natural inclusion of service + location |
| E-E-A-T signals | Demonstrates real experience |
| Link attraction | Quality projects get shared and linked |
| Conversion support | Builds trust with prospects |
Portfolio Best Practices:
- Professional photography essential
- Include variety of project types
- Show different budget levels
- Update regularly with new completions
- Include client testimonials where possible
- Add technical details that demonstrate expertise
Technical SEO for Construction Websites
Technical foundations matter for construction sites:
Site Structure:
Clear hierarchy supporting both users and search engines:
Homepage
├── Services
│ ├── House Extensions
│ ├── New Builds
│ ├── Loft Conversions
│ └── Commercial Fit-outs
├── Areas We Serve
│ ├── Belfast
│ ├── Lisburn
│ └── [Other locations]
├── Portfolio
│ ├── Residential Projects
│ └── Commercial Projects
├── About Us
│ ├── Our Team
│ └── Accreditations
└── Contact
Page Speed:
Construction websites often suffer from slow loading due to large images:
- Compress all images
- Use modern formats (WebP)
- Implement lazy loading
- Use CDN for image delivery
- Optimise hosting
Mobile Optimisation:
Many construction searches happen on mobile:
- Responsive design essential
- Click-to-call functionality
- Easy contact forms
- Fast mobile loading
- Readable on small screens
Schema Markup:
Key Schema Types:
– LocalBusiness / GeneralContractor
– Service
– Place (for service areas)
– Review
– ImageObject (for portfolio)
Review Management
Reviews significantly impact construction company visibility:
Review Importance:
Construction involves high trust and high investment. Reviews provide:
- Social proof of quality
- Risk reduction for prospects
- Local ranking signals
- Keyword-rich content (naturally)
Review Generation:
Timing:
- Project completion (snagging resolved)
- After positive interactions
- When clients express satisfaction
Methods:
- Direct request from project manager
- Email with direct review link
- Follow-up call with review request
- QR code on completion documentation
Platforms:
- Google Business Profile (priority)
- Checkatrade (if member)
- Trustpilot
- Houzz
- MyBuilder
Review Response:
All Reviews:
- Respond to every review
- Personalise responses
- Reference project type/location
- Thank for choosing your company
Negative Reviews:
- Respond promptly and professionally
- Acknowledge concerns
- Offer resolution
- Don’t be defensive
- Take detailed discussions offline

How much does SEO for construction companies cost?
Construction SEO typically ranges from £800-£2,000/month for local contractors to £2,000-£5,000+/month for larger firms or multiple service areas. Costs depend on competition, geographic scope, and service breadth. Given high project values, ROI from SEO is typically strong—one additional project can justify a significant investment.
How long does construction SEO take to work?
Google Business Profile improvements can show results within weeks. Local ranking improvements typically appear within 3-6 months. Competitive service terms may take 6-12+ months. Construction SEO often benefits from lower competition than other industries, potentially accelerating results.
Can small builders compete with large construction firms online?
Yes, often effectively. Large firms may have brand recognition but often have generic, corporate websites. Small builders can compete through: local focus, specific service specialisation, personal service emphasis, and stronger review profiles. Target specific searches where your expertise is genuine rather than competing for broad terms.
How important are photos and portfolios for construction SEO?
Extremely important. Project photography serves multiple purposes: it demonstrates capability, provides unique content, supports Google Business Profile, enables case studies, and builds trust. Professional photography of completed projects is one of the highest-value investments for construction marketing.
Should we include prices on our website?
Guidance rather than fixed prices works best for construction. Include: typical project ranges, factors affecting cost, budget guidance, and a transparent pricing approach. Avoid “price on application” with no guidance—it frustrates searchers. Help people understand whether they can afford your services before they enquire.
How do we get reviews when projects take months?
Build review requests into project completion processes. Time requests for project handover when satisfaction is high. Consider interim reviews for very long projects. Train project managers to request reviews. Make it easy with direct links. Even a few reviews per year build over time.
What’s the most important thing for construction SEO?
Google Business Profile optimisation with strong project imagery and consistent review generation. These elements have the most immediate impact on local visibility. A well-optimised GBP with quality photos and good reviews outperforms competitors regardless of website sophistication in most local construction searches.
